Abstract

The dark-dependent degradation of TOC1 protein in Arabidopsis thaliana requires functional ZEITLUPE (ZTL).

  • A physical interaction between TOC1 and ZTL is crucial for the regulation of TOC1 protein levels.
  • Mutations in ztl-1 disrupt the interaction, leading to constant TOC1 protein expression.
  • The degradation of TOC1 is linked to circadian rhythms and may influence the overall circadian period.
  • Inhibition of the proteosome pathway prevents the dark-dependent degradation of TOC1.
